gourd 葫芦来自拉丁语cucurbita, 葫芦,词源可能同cucumber.
- gourd (n.)
- c. 1300, from Anglo-French gourde, Old French coorde, ultimately from Latin cucurbita "gourd," which is of uncertain origin, perhaps related to cucumis "cucumber." Dried and excavated, the shell was used as a scoop or dipper.
